Essential Requirements The Registration to Work with Vulnerable People Act 2013 requires persons undertaking work in a regulated activity to be registered.
A regulated activity is a child related service or activity defined in the Registration to Work with Vulnerable People Regulations 2014.
This registration must remain current and valid at all times whilst employed in this role and the status of this may be checked at any time during employment.
Current Tasmanian Registration to Work with Vulnerable People (Registration Status – Employment) In accordance with section 106 (a) and (b) of the Education Act 2016, all Principals must be a registered teacher with full registration within the meaning of the Teachers Registration Act 2000.
Satisfactory completion of the School Leadership and Management Prerequisites (SLMP) Desirable Requirements Four years or more training as defined in the Teaching Service (Tasmanian Public Sector) Award 2005.
